Avlon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Avlon in the United States is $75,871.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$36. Salaries at Avlon typically range from $66,721 to $86,098 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

How Much Does Avlon Pay for Different Roles?

Explore detailed salary information for specific jobs at Avlon. Based on our data, the highest paying job is the Director of Finance and Accounting, with an annual salary of $191,976. The table below outlines the annual salary ranges for most popular roles within the company.

About AVLON
Avlon Industries manufacturers of Affirm, FiberGuard, KeraCare, MoisturColor, Ferm, and Professional Hair Care Products.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Atlanta?

Understanding the cost of living near Atlanta is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Avlon.
Atlanta's Cost of Living Index is approximately 105.0 (5.0% more expensive than US average; 12.9% more than GA average). Major SE hub, housing costs above US avg, especially in desirable neighborhoods. MARTA rail/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Avlon,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,500 - $2,300+ A significant portion of Avlon sal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$95 (MART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,945 - $4,625+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
